The Indian economy is growing rapidly, leading to an ever-increasing demand for a skilled workforce. This enhances the relevance of the LABS model, which has won wide acclaim – both in India and abroad – for its simplicity and effectiveness.
LABS has evolved into a robust model that can effectively be adapted to a wide range of local conditions, both urban and rural, thus making it easily replicable and scalable. Its ability to quickly create sustainable livelihoods through market-savvy vocational training programs has attracted several socially-oriented organizations, which have been implementing the model and scaling it up for their specific requirements.
To broad-base the LABS model to cater to larger target groups, DRF constantly explores possible avenues of association with process-oriented organizations, thereby enabling them to take it forward in locations where we do not have a direct presence. |
